Laos - Import of Nickel-Iron Electric Accumulators
At $594,124 in 2016, the country was number 14 among other countries in Import of Nickel-Iron Electric Accumulators. Laos is overtaken by Malaysia, which was number 13 at $598,962.15 and is followed by Malawi with $551,511.4. Denmark lead the ranking with $7,322,222.5 in 2019, that is a fall of 5.1% versus 2018. Israel, United States and Ethiopia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Fiji witnessed the best average annual growth at +493% per year, while Burundi recorded the worst performance at -84.9% per year.
